About the Role
This Position provides excellent guest service and cleaning services such as sweeping, mopping, dusting, vacuuming, washing walls, windows and mirrors, etc. in cabins and common areas. Ultimately, you will ensure a pleasant and comfortable experience for our guests during their stay with us.
Responsibilities
- Load the outpost vehicle with cleaning equipment, extra guest supplies, and firewood.
- Prep cabin interiors by removing trash, stripping linens, and re-stocking provisions.
- Ensure every cabin’s outdoor space is perfectly staged by cleaning and staging the lounge area, cleaning cabin exteriors, and removing all trash.
- Respond to guest concerns, complaints, or suggestions appropriately, referring them to management.
- Gather waste and/or contaminated materials for disposal in cabins, trails, and common areas.
- Maintain privacy and security by announcing entry and servicing cabins as appropriate.
- Use and maintain assigned equipment and supplies to departmental specifications.
- Maintain the daily log, including accounting for completed tasks and reviewing the communications log.
- Handle lost and found items in accordance with department policies and security procedures.
- Perform other duties as assigned by Management.
- Keep immediate supervisor promptly and fully informed of all problems or matters of significance.
- Solve problems proactively in an efficient, effective, and professional manner.
- Operate with integrity and sound judgment, respect team and guests, and hold yourself accountable.
- Adhere to standard operating procedures and company values.
- Adhere to safety policies to maintain a safe work environment.
